docs: complete BACKLOG.md rewrite with prioritized tasks
Full task audit completed April 6, 2026: - 30 active tasks organized by priority - 4 HIGH priority (revenue/force multipliers) - 7 MEDIUM priority (operations) - 11 LOW priority (nice-to-have) - 7 PERSONAL/HOLLY track - 1 BLOCKED (Ignis Protocol) Removed obsolete Ghost/Paymenter tasks. Added recently completed section. Clear instructions for task management. Signed-off-by: Claude (Chronicler #62) <claude@firefrostgaming.com>
This commit is contained in:
236
BACKLOG.md
236
BACKLOG.md
@@ -1,193 +1,155 @@
|
||||
# 📋 BACKLOG - Future Work Parking Lot
|
||||
# 📋 BACKLOG — Prioritized Task List
|
||||
|
||||
**Last Updated:** April 1, 2026 by Chronicler #54
|
||||
**Purpose:** Organized collection of tasks that don't block soft launch
|
||||
|
||||
**This is NOT prioritized.** Items here are "someday/maybe" work organized by theme for easy reference.
|
||||
**Last Updated:** April 6, 2026 by Chronicler #62
|
||||
**Purpose:** Organized, prioritized collection of active tasks
|
||||
|
||||
---
|
||||
|
||||
## 🏗️ INFRASTRUCTURE
|
||||
## 🔴 PRIORITY 1 — HIGH (Do Soon)
|
||||
|
||||
### Server & System Management
|
||||
- NC1 Node Usage Stats Not Reporting (Wings monitoring)
|
||||
- Netdata Deployment (system monitoring)
|
||||
- Command Center Security Hardening
|
||||
- The Frostwall Protocol - GRE Tunnel Security Architecture
|
||||
- Vaultwarden - Add SSH Key & Org Setup
|
||||
These tasks have direct revenue impact or are major force multipliers.
|
||||
|
||||
### Automation & Tooling
|
||||
- Rank System Deployment - Full Network Automation
|
||||
- Paymenter → Pterodactyl Auto-Provisioning Integration
|
||||
- Server Deletion Policy Implementation
|
||||
- Pterodactyl Extensions (Blueprint modules)
|
||||
| # | Task | Notes |
|
||||
|---|------|-------|
|
||||
| 26 | Modpack Version Checker | Commercial product for BuiltByBit, passive income potential |
|
||||
| 93 | Trinity Codex (Dify/Qdrant) | RAG system for Trinity, architecture complete |
|
||||
| 94 | Global Restart Scheduler | 680-line spec complete, reduces manual server work |
|
||||
| — | Trinity Console 2.0 | 1,776-line implementation guide exists |
|
||||
|
||||
---
|
||||
|
||||
## 👥 COMMUNITY & STAFF
|
||||
## 🟡 PRIORITY 2 — MEDIUM (Important but not urgent)
|
||||
|
||||
### Staff Management
|
||||
- Staff Recruitment Launch
|
||||
- Holly Builder Rank Setup (LuckPerms + permissions)
|
||||
- Department Structure & Access Control Matrix
|
||||
- Staff Onboarding Documentation
|
||||
Operational improvements and infrastructure hardening.
|
||||
|
||||
### Community Features
|
||||
- Community Response Template Library
|
||||
- Social Media Content Calendar
|
||||
- Emissary Social Media Launch (Meg's domain)
|
||||
| # | Task | Notes |
|
||||
|---|------|-------|
|
||||
| 48 | n8n Rebuild | Automation backbone, workflows from scratch |
|
||||
| 67 | NC1 Security & Temp Monitoring | Protect hardware investment |
|
||||
| 40 | World Backup Automation | Data protection |
|
||||
| 22 | Netdata Deployment | System monitoring on all servers |
|
||||
| 92 | Desktop MCP + Dispatch | Architecture done, blocked on hardware (Pi) |
|
||||
| 77 | Community Response Templates | Helps Meg scale community management |
|
||||
| — | Brand Guidelines PDF Review | Upload from Chromebook, add fonts |
|
||||
|
||||
---
|
||||
|
||||
## 🎨 CONTENT & DESIGN
|
||||
## 🟢 PRIORITY 3 — LOW (Backlog, do when time allows)
|
||||
|
||||
### Website Content
|
||||
- Ghost CMS Full Buildout (beyond homepage)
|
||||
- Fire + Frost Design System Widget
|
||||
- Server Showcase Pages
|
||||
- Community Spotlight Features
|
||||
- YouTube Integration
|
||||
Nice-to-have improvements and documentation.
|
||||
|
||||
### Branding & Assets
|
||||
- **Brand Guidelines PDF - Review & Complete** (upload from Chromebook, add fonts, verify colors)
|
||||
- Terraria Branding Arc (Michael's texture pack training)
|
||||
- Server Texture Pack Development
|
||||
- Custom Resource Packs
|
||||
- Promotional Materials
|
||||
| # | Task | Notes |
|
||||
|---|------|-------|
|
||||
| 23 | Department Structure & Access Control | Access control matrix |
|
||||
| 27 | Server Sunset Evaluation | Which servers to retire |
|
||||
| 46 | Server-to-Server SSH Keys | Infrastructure convenience |
|
||||
| 72 | Infrastructure Health Dashboard | Visual server/service map |
|
||||
| 74 | SSH Key Auto-Setup Script | Chronicler onboarding helper |
|
||||
| 79 | Infrastructure Quick Reference | Documentation |
|
||||
| 49 | NotebookLM Integration | Audio knowledge base, experimental |
|
||||
| 80 | Task Scaffolding Tool | Meta-tooling for task creation |
|
||||
| 81 | Memorial Writing Assistant | Chronicler convenience tool |
|
||||
| 89 | DERP Protocol Review | Formalization of existing protocol |
|
||||
| 82 | Decommission Plane | Cleanup (may already be done) |
|
||||
|
||||
---
|
||||
|
||||
## 📊 BUSINESS & LEGAL
|
||||
## 🟣 PRIORITY 4 — PERSONAL / HOLLY (Different track)
|
||||
|
||||
### Business Structure
|
||||
- Fire + Frost Holdings - Business Restructuring
|
||||
- LegalCORPS Minnesota Consultation (Ignis Protocol age verification)
|
||||
- Payment Processing Optimization
|
||||
- Tax & Accounting Setup
|
||||
Personal projects and Trinity member tasks.
|
||||
|
||||
### Operations
|
||||
- Paymenter Support Page → Discord Redirect
|
||||
- Refund Policy Documentation
|
||||
- Chargeback Prevention Strategy
|
||||
| # | Task | Owner | Notes |
|
||||
|---|------|-------|-------|
|
||||
| 25 | Pokerole WikiJS Content | Holly + Claudius | Aurelian Pokédex publication |
|
||||
| 32 | Terraria Branding Arc | Michael | Personal texture pack training |
|
||||
| 57 | Trinity Image - Commit to Branding | Trinity | When ready |
|
||||
| 61 | AI Minecraft Skins - Trinity | Trinity | Fun project |
|
||||
| 62 | Wizard Skin Upload | Michael | Upload to account |
|
||||
| 63 | Emissary Skin Upload | Meg | Upload to account |
|
||||
| 64 | Catalyst Skin Upload | Holly | Upload to account |
|
||||
|
||||
---
|
||||
|
||||
## 🤖 AI & AUTOMATION
|
||||
## ⛔ BLOCKED
|
||||
|
||||
### Development Tools
|
||||
- Firefrost Codex Enhancements (Dify + Ollama)
|
||||
- Memorial Writing Assistant
|
||||
- Task Scaffolding Tool
|
||||
- Gemini Consultation Helper
|
||||
- Task Dependency Visualizer
|
||||
|
||||
### Self-Hosted AI
|
||||
- Ollama Model Optimization
|
||||
- Qdrant Vector DB Tuning
|
||||
- RAG Pipeline Improvements
|
||||
| # | Task | Blocker |
|
||||
|---|------|---------|
|
||||
| 51 | Ignis Protocol | Waiting on LegalCORPS consultation |
|
||||
|
||||
---
|
||||
|
||||
## 🎮 GAME SERVER FEATURES
|
||||
## ✅ RECENTLY COMPLETED
|
||||
|
||||
### Minecraft Enhancements
|
||||
- Modpack Version Checker (already deployed)
|
||||
- Custom Plugin Development
|
||||
- Server Event System
|
||||
- Mini-Game Integration
|
||||
|
||||
### Multi-Game Support
|
||||
- Terraria Server Setup
|
||||
- Valheim Server Planning
|
||||
- Cross-Game Rank Sync
|
||||
| # | Task | Completed | By |
|
||||
|---|------|-----------|-----|
|
||||
| 2 | Rank System Deployment | April 2026 | Holly |
|
||||
| 34 | Consultant Photo Processing | April 6, 2026 | Archived to laptop |
|
||||
| 39 | LuckPerms MySQL Backend | April 2026 | Michael |
|
||||
| 75 | Gemini Consultation Procedure | April 6, 2026 | Chronicler #62 |
|
||||
| 76 | Social Media Content Calendar | April 6, 2026 | Resolved via Gemini (Phase 2) |
|
||||
| 87 | Arbiter Lifecycle Handlers | April 6, 2026 | Chronicler #62 |
|
||||
| 91 | Server Matrix Node Detection | April 2026 | Complete |
|
||||
|
||||
---
|
||||
|
||||
## 🔧 TECHNICAL DEBT
|
||||
## ❌ OBSOLETE (Removed from tracking)
|
||||
|
||||
### Code Quality
|
||||
- Arbiter Code Refactoring
|
||||
- Whitelist Manager Modernization
|
||||
- Test Suite Development
|
||||
- Documentation Updates
|
||||
These tasks are no longer relevant due to architecture changes:
|
||||
|
||||
### Infrastructure Cleanup
|
||||
- MkDocs Decommissioning (replaced by Wiki.js)
|
||||
- Legacy Service Removal
|
||||
- Database Optimization
|
||||
- Backup Strategy Hardening
|
||||
**Ghost CMS Retired (April 2, 2026):**
|
||||
- #13, #28, #52, #53, #58, #59, #68, #69, #88
|
||||
|
||||
**Paymenter Retired (April 3, 2026):**
|
||||
- #33, #71, #83, #85
|
||||
|
||||
**Other:**
|
||||
- #12, #17 — Holly Staff Onboarding (she's Trinity now)
|
||||
- #73 — Task Dependency Visualizer (old Gitea system)
|
||||
- #78 — Design System Widget (superseded by Brand Guidelines PDF)
|
||||
|
||||
---
|
||||
|
||||
## 💡 FUTURE FEATURES (Phase 2+)
|
||||
## 📊 SUMMARY
|
||||
|
||||
### Trinity Console Enhancements
|
||||
- Task Management Module (non-technical interface for Meg/Holly)
|
||||
- Subscriber Analytics Deep Dive
|
||||
- Automated Reporting
|
||||
- Mobile App Companion
|
||||
|
||||
### Advanced Automation
|
||||
- Predictive Grace Period Recovery
|
||||
- Churn Analysis
|
||||
- Referral Program Automation
|
||||
- Community Health Metrics
|
||||
|
||||
### Community Tools
|
||||
- Wiki.js Content Expansion (Pokerole entries)
|
||||
- Player Achievement System
|
||||
- Community Events Calendar
|
||||
- Contest & Giveaway Management
|
||||
|
||||
---
|
||||
|
||||
## 📁 ARCHIVED TASKS
|
||||
|
||||
Tasks from the old system (March 30, 2026) that are:
|
||||
- Completed
|
||||
- Obsolete
|
||||
- Superseded by other work
|
||||
|
||||
**See:** `docs/archive/tasks-historical-march-30-2026.md`
|
||||
**See:** `docs/archive/gitea-issues-archive-2026-04-01.md`
|
||||
|
||||
**Total Historical Tasks:** 97 tasks documented
|
||||
**Gitea Issues Archived:** 50 issues closed
|
||||
|
||||
These archives provide context for decisions made and work completed.
|
||||
| Priority | Count |
|
||||
|----------|-------|
|
||||
| HIGH | 4 |
|
||||
| MEDIUM | 7 |
|
||||
| LOW | 11 |
|
||||
| PERSONAL | 7 |
|
||||
| BLOCKED | 1 |
|
||||
| **TOTAL ACTIVE** | **30** |
|
||||
|
||||
---
|
||||
|
||||
## 🎯 HOW TO USE THIS FILE
|
||||
|
||||
### Adding Items
|
||||
1. Identify theme (Infrastructure, Community, Content, Business, etc.)
|
||||
2. Add brief description under appropriate section
|
||||
3. No need for time estimates or priorities
|
||||
4. This is a parking lot, not a roadmap
|
||||
|
||||
### Promoting Items to BLOCKERS.md
|
||||
### Promoting to BLOCKERS.md
|
||||
When something becomes urgent:
|
||||
1. Move to BLOCKERS.md
|
||||
1. Move to BLOCKERS.md with full details
|
||||
2. Add time estimate, status, assignment
|
||||
3. Remove from BACKLOG.md (or mark as promoted)
|
||||
3. Mark as "promoted" here or remove
|
||||
|
||||
### Adding New Tasks
|
||||
1. Assign next available task number
|
||||
2. Place in appropriate priority section
|
||||
3. Add brief notes
|
||||
|
||||
### Regular Grooming
|
||||
- Monthly review: Remove obsolete items
|
||||
- Quarterly review: Reorganize themes if needed
|
||||
- Annual review: Archive old backlog, start fresh
|
||||
- Weekly: Check if any LOW items should move up
|
||||
- Monthly: Archive completed items
|
||||
- Quarterly: Full audit like today's session
|
||||
|
||||
---
|
||||
|
||||
## 📊 BACKLOG STATISTICS
|
||||
## 📁 ARCHIVES
|
||||
|
||||
**Total Items:** ~40+ tasks
|
||||
**Organized By:** 7 major themes
|
||||
**Average Age:** Varies (some from February 2026, some future ideas)
|
||||
**Completion Rate:** Not tracked (this is a parking lot)
|
||||
**Historical task documentation:**
|
||||
- `docs/archive/tasks-historical-march-30-2026.md` — 97 tasks documented
|
||||
- `docs/archive/gitea-issues-archive-2026-04-01.md` — 50 issues closed
|
||||
|
||||
---
|
||||
|
||||
**Fire + Frost + Foundation = Where Love Builds Legacy** 🔥❄️
|
||||
|
||||
*The backlog exists to capture ideas without the pressure of immediate action.*
|
||||
*Last audit: April 6, 2026 — Chronicler #62*
|
||||
|
||||
Reference in New Issue
Block a user